This essay whose research object is Apostichopus japonicus is to discuss temperature, salinity, pH and photoperiodic which have effects on the growth and behavior of Apostichopus japonicus. Consequently, discuss the pH cause by cement-sand-skerry. By measuring the SGR and NIW, which reflect the growth of Apostichopus japonicus.The temperature group which are divided into six division, investigated the effect on Apostichopus japonicus which is managed by temperature treatment by 40 days. The trend of growing is increasing at fisrt but decreasing at last. The maximal SGR of Apostichopus japonicus at 17℃is 2.031±2.772%·d-1. The maximal growth of NIW is 9.247±12.179g. According to curvilinear regression of temperature and SGR of Apostichopus japonicus, the most proper temperature is 16.8℃. The salinity group is divided into six division, investigated the effect on Apostichopus japonicus, which is managed by salinity treatment by 40 days. The maximal SGR at salinity 30 is 3.067±2.069%·d-1. The incresement is 9.247±12.179g. According to curvilinear regression of salinity and SGR of Apostichopus japonicus, the most proper salinity is 31.Establish the adjustment of pH of the sea caused by the cement-sand-skerry. The cement-sand-skerry which is composed by cement and sand at a proportion of 1:5 has obvious effect. The ascent of pH caused by the casting of cement-sand-skerry restrains the growth of Apostichopus japonicus.The photoperiodic group is divided into six division. When the photoperiodic is 12h:12h, the SGR comes to the highest level of 0.960%·d-1, and the maximum NIW reaches to 12.302g.This article analized the variation of temperature, salinity, pH and photoperiodic which have effects on the regularity of Apostichopus japonicus, and discussed the rang of the most proper enviromental factors.Through controling the enviromental factors, discover the statistics, and to help the feeding of Apostichopus japonicus. To make Apostichopus japonicus grow in the most proper enviroment, and raise to the surviving and growing rate. This researchment will have great impact on the feeding of Apostichopus japonicus.
